Transaction 1223ed578654862826066390c5ff61382916764baa2fc0aa5f9de98ea06b0958
1 Input
1 Output
-
1223ed578654862826066390c5ff61382916764baa2fc0aa5f9de98ea06b0958:0
- value
- 105130500
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9f6f2bfc0d2965a98892757578749918fb66407
- address
- bc1ql8m0907q62t94xyfyat40p6fjx8mveq8cf64g3